Refactor get_sign_bit_cost
Change-Id: I646e93abb1064d05bac625ba4c567d377b249367
diff --git a/av1/encoder/encodetxb.c b/av1/encoder/encodetxb.c
index cac1aa5..3c447d5 100644
--- a/av1/encoder/encodetxb.c
+++ b/av1/encoder/encodetxb.c
@@ -243,9 +243,8 @@
static INLINE int get_sign_bit_cost(tran_low_t qc, int coeff_idx,
const int (*dc_sign_cost)[2],
int dc_sign_ctx) {
- const int sign = (qc < 0) ? 1 : 0;
- // sign bit cost
if (coeff_idx == 0) {
+ const int sign = (qc < 0) ? 1 : 0;
return dc_sign_cost[dc_sign_ctx][sign];
}
return av1_cost_literal(1);